Home
Jobs

Senior C++ Software Engineer

5 - 7 years

40 - 45 Lacs

Posted:1 week ago| Platform: Naukri logo

Apply

Work Mode

Hybrid

Job Type

Full Time

Job Description

Expected Notice Period: 15 Days
Shift: (GMT+05:30) Asia/Kolkata (IST)
Opportunity Type: Hybrid (Bengaluru)
Placement Type: Full Time Permanent position(Payroll and Compliance to be managed by: TruU, Inc)
(*Note: This is a requirement for one of Uplers' client - TruU, Inc)

What do you need for this opportunity?

Must have skills required:
AI/ML, Cloud Computing, DevSecOps, Algorithms, Datastructures, C#, C++, Python, Swift, TDD
TruU, Inc is Looking for:

Senior C++ Software Engineer



Key Responsibilities

Spearhead the design and implementation of C++ software tailored to collecting sensor data and

using it with Deep Neural Network (DNN) models to derive unique insights about user behavior.

Collaborate with globally distributed team of data scientists and software engineers to

successfully implement a high-quality product for deployment in demanding IT environments of

medium and large Enterprise customers.

Optimize software performance to minimize impact on other applications and user experience

by fine-tuning compute, memory, and disk usage.


Keep abreast of industry trends and best practices in AI/ML software development for resource-

constrained environments and apply those lessons in the development of product.


Translate Python code developed by data scientists into modular and efficient C++

implementation.

Utilize all available resources to solve problems that may not align with your domain expertise.

Requirements

Hold at least a bachelor's degree in computer science, or another related STEM field.

Must have a minimum of 5 years of professional software development experience in C++ 11 or

newer.

Strong knowledge of data structures and algorithms.

Good understanding of object-oriented design using common design patterns.

Must have a thorough understanding of developing multithreaded applications.

Show a thorough grasp of writing applications for resource-limited environments.

Possess excellent communication and teamwork skills.

Nice to Have

Prior experience developing cross-platform endpoint applications.

A working knowledge of Python, Swift, or C#.


Ability to demonstrate prior experience in developing complex C++ code in areas like endpoint-

agent development, gaming, kernel development, embedded systems programming, real-time


systems, HPC or AI/ML on a desktop.

A basic understanding of basic AI/ML/Data-Science concepts. Prior experience developing

AI/ML products is a plus.

Prior experience with Test-Driven Development (TDD) approach for building high quality

products.

Some experience developing and deploying code to send agent telemetry to cloud (AWS/Azure)

is highly desirable.

Prior experience working in geographically diverse teams spread across multiple time-zones.

Familiarity with modern DEVSECOPS tooling and techniques for automating product

build/testing pipelines is a plus.

Ability and willingness to mentor junior engineers.

Benefits

Competitive salary


Comprehensive health, insurance plans

Flexible work hours, vacation plan, and a hybrid work setup

Professional growth and development opportunities

Global, collaborative, and inclusive company culture

Mock Interview

Practice Video Interview with JobPe AI

Start Technical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Uplers
Uplers

Digital Services

Ahmedabad

200+ Employees

7127 Jobs

    Key People

  • Karan Singh

    Co-founder & CEO
  • Nitesh Gohil

    Co-founder

RecommendedJobs for You